Class
KeyBindingCollection

Represents KeyBindings collection.

Definition

Namespace:Telerik.UI.Xaml.Controls.PdfViewer.Commands

Assembly:Telerik.WinUI.Controls.PdfViewer.dll

Syntax:

cs-api-definition
public class KeyBindingCollection

Inheritance: objectKeyBindingCollection

Methods

Add(KeyboardAccelerator)

Adds the specified keyboard accelerator.

Declaration

cs-api-definition
public void Add(KeyboardAccelerator keyboardAccelerator)

Parameters

keyboardAccelerator

KeyboardAccelerator

The keyboard accelerator.

AddRange(IEnumerable<KeyboardAccelerator>)

Adds the range.

Declaration

cs-api-definition
public void AddRange(IEnumerable<KeyboardAccelerator> keyboardAccelerators)

Parameters

keyboardAccelerators

IEnumerable<KeyboardAccelerator>

The keyboard accelerators.

Clear()

Clears keyboard accelerators.

Declaration

cs-api-definition
public void Clear()

RegisterCommandDescriptor(CommandDescriptorBase, VirtualKey, VirtualKeyModifiers)

Registers the command descriptor.

Declaration

cs-api-definition
public void RegisterCommandDescriptor(CommandDescriptorBase commandDescriptor, VirtualKey key, VirtualKeyModifiers modifierKeys = 0)

Parameters

commandDescriptor

CommandDescriptorBase

The command descriptor.

key

VirtualKey

The key.

modifierKeys

VirtualKeyModifiers

The modifier keys.

SetKeyboardAccelerators(IList<KeyboardAccelerator>)

Sets the keyboard accelerators.

Declaration

cs-api-definition
public void SetKeyboardAccelerators(IList<KeyboardAccelerator> keyboardAccelerators)

Parameters

keyboardAccelerators

IList<KeyboardAccelerator>

The keyboard accelerators.